Obituary

Olga C. Mendez was born in Clarkwood, TX on September 10,1932 to Elias Cerrillo and Francisca Paez. She passed away to be with the Lord and her beloved husband on January 20, 2025 surrounded by her children.

Olga is survived by her children Roy Mendez and his wife Martha,  Rose Mary Hernandez and her husband Armando, Jose Manuel Mendez and his wife Christine, Frances Traspena and her husband Dean, and her sisters Lilia Cerrillo Paez and Amparo C. Paniagua, 16 grandchildren, 23 great grandchildren and 2 great great grandchildren.  She is preceded in death by her husband of 68 years Jose Mendez, her mother Francisca Paez, her father Elias Cerrillo, her son Waldo Mendez, her granddaughter Ashlee Nicole Traspena, three sisters and one brother.


Olga was a homemaker for 22 years where she enjoyed raising her five children and managing the family life. In 1979 she started her career working various positions for Edgewood ISD where she retired as a Child Nutrition Manager in May of 1997. Olga was loved by many of the students who lovingly called her "grandma". She enjoyed going shopping, playing poker and Shanghai with her family.  She also enjoyed watching football on Sundays, especially Patrick Mahomes and the Kansas City Chiefs. Olga had a great sense of humor and was famous for her quick wit she often used while chatting with her children and grandchildren.
